Output 6d63f5a48d309ffa65278a3b819a9702d542f44c58b0acd1c16898f94b676999:3

value
4859476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9338a1ad7d8f3fc69365a43a308a4601b9a2866 OP_EQUAL
address
3QQfvLNcow7RajCGH9C7UowE2t3fMCs56X
transaction
6d63f5a48d309ffa65278a3b819a9702d542f44c58b0acd1c16898f94b676999
confirmations
164737
spent
true